Guido Haenen

Assistant Professor

Prof/ Guido Haenen is currently Professor in 'Redox Modulation of Pharmacological and Toxicological Processes'. He was registered as Pharmacist in 1985 (with honours), and he obtained his PhD in Medicinal Chemistry in 1989. He was awarded the ‘Shell Prize’ for his thesis entitled ‘Thiols in Oxidative Stress’. Prof. Haenen is registered as Toxicologist and Clinical Pharmacologist. In 2015, he received the 'Grote Onderwijsprijs' (education prize) for being the best teacher in Biomedical Sciences at Maastricht University. He is Editor-in-Chief of the Molecular Toxicology section of the International Journal of Molecular Sciences.
